What is a Script Engineer?

A Script Engineer is a professional responsible for writing, maintaining, and optimizing scripts that automate tasks, processes, or workflows within software systems. They often work with scripting languages like Python, Bash, PowerShell, or JavaScript to streamline operations, improve efficiency, and support software development or IT operations. Script Engineers may also troubleshoot scripts, integrate them with other tools, and ensure they follow best coding practices.

How does a Script Engineer typically collaborate with development and operations teams on automation projects?

Script Engineers regularly work alongside software developers and IT operations teams to design, implement, and maintain automation scripts that streamline workflows and system processes. Collaboration often involves gathering requirements, understanding system architectures, and troubleshooting issues together to ensure seamless integration of automation solutions. Effective communication and problem-solving skills are essential, as Script Engineers frequently participate in code reviews, cross-functional meetings, and documentation efforts to keep all stakeholders informed and projects on track.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Script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Script Engineer, you need strong programming skills, typically in scripting languages such as Python, Bash, or PowerShell, along with a solid understanding of software development principles. Familiarity with automation tools, version control systems like Git, and continuous integration platforms is commonly required. Probl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ication help Script Engineers collaborate and deliver reliable automation solutions. These skills are essential for improving efficiency, reducing manual errors, and supporting seamless software development and deployment processes.
